As the New York Knicks gear up for their matchup against the Los Angeles Clippers on Wednesday, they will do so without the services of Josh Hart and Landry Shamet. Both players remain sidelined due to ongoing injury concerns, a situation that leaves the Knicks with a significant challenge as they look to secure a crucial victory.

Josh Hart, known for his scrappy defense and versatility, is currently dealing with an ankle injury that has kept him off the court for several games. His absence is felt especially in the Knicks’ rotation, where his ability to contribute on both ends of the floor is invaluable. Sources told Yahoo Sports that Hart has been making strides in his rehabilitation, but the coaching staff has decided to err on the side of caution, ensuring he has ample time to recover before returning to action.

Landry Shamet, who has been a key contributor off the bench, is also out due to his own injury woes. The Knicks have been managing his condition carefully, and as reported by Yahoo Sports, there is still no definitive timeline for his return. Without these two players, New York’s depth will be tested, particularly against a strong Clippers team that boasts a potent offensive lineup featuring superstars like Kawhi Leonard and Paul George.
